25;;; Commentary:
26
722074ef
RS
27;; Automatically save place in files, so that visiting them later
28;; (even during a different Emacs session) automatically moves point
29;; to the saved position, when the file is first found. Uses the
30;; value of buffer-local variable save-place to determine whether to
31;; save position or not.
